TomTom Rider 550 GPS Update
The TomTom Rider 550 is built for motorcycle navigation—keeping it updated ensures you’re riding with the latest maps, speed limits, and performance features. This guide provides easy-to-follow instructions for updating your Rider 550 GPS device.
Why Update Your TomTom Rider 550?
- Get the most recent maps and route changes for motorcyclists
- Access updated Points of Interest like gas stations and rest stops
- Enhance device responsiveness and software reliability
- Fix connectivity issues and optimize Bluetooth performance
What You’ll Need
- TomTom Rider 550 GPS unit
- USB cable or a Wi-Fi connection
- MyDrive Connect software (for USB updates)
- TomTom account credentials
How to Update TomTom Rider 550
Option 1: Update via Wi-Fi
Connect your Rider 550 to a Wi-Fi network. On the device, go to Settings > Updates & New Items and follow the prompts to install available updates directly—no computer needed.
Option 2: Update via MyDrive Connect
- Install MyDrive Connect on your computer
- Connect the GPS to your PC via USB
- Launch the app, sign in, and install updates shown
Troubleshooting Tips
- Wi-Fi won’t connect: Reboot the device and try a different network
- Device not recognized: Use another USB cable or reinstall MyDrive
- Slow updates: Ensure a fast and stable internet connection
